Santa Barbara, CA—In practice, requirements engineering tasks have become increasingly complex. In order to ensure a high level of knowledge and competency among requirements engineers, the International Requirements Engineering Board (IREB) developed a standardized qualification called the Certified Professional for Requirements Engineering (CPRE). The certification defines the practical skills of a requirements engineer on various training levels.

Requirements Engineering Fundamentals (Rocky Nook, $39.95 USD) is designed for self-study and covers the curriculum for the Certified Professional for Requirements Engineering Foundation Level exam as defined by the IREB.

About IREB: The mission of the International Requirements Engineering Board is to contribute to the standardization of further education in the fields of business analysis and requirements engineering by providing syllabi and examinations, thereby achieving a general improvement of applied requirements engineering.

The IRE Board is comprised of a balanced mix of independent, internationally recognized experts in the fields of economy, consulting, research, and science. The IREB is a non-profit corporation.

About the Authors

Klaus Pohl holds a full professorship for Software Systems Engineering at paluno: The Ruhr Institute for Software Engineering at the University of Duisburg-Essen. His research interests include requirements engineering; software-intensive, service-based systems; and software product lines. He has coordinated many international and national research projects, served as program and general chair for several international conferences, and published over 150 peer-reviewed articles. As a consultant he supports industry and public organizations to improve the requirements engineering processes.

In 15 years of active involvement in the field of systems engineering, Chris Rupp (General Manager, SOPHIST GmbH) has built a company, published 6 books, hired 40 employees, and gained plenty of experience. She has spent much of her career working as a project consultant, managing and supporting others as they strive to meet the goals of their individual projects.

About Rocky Nook
Rocky Nook's books are distributed internationally by O'Reilly Media.

Rocky Nook was founded in early 2006 in Santa Barbara, California, and is closely associated with dpunkt.verlag, a leading publisher of books on technology based in Heidelberg, Germany. The focus of Rocky Nook's publications is on digital photography and computing.
